A cell culture with a concentration of 1.5x10^6 cells/ml has an absorbance at 600nm of 0.15. When the absorbance of the culture reaches 0.45 the cell concentration will be?

Answer #1

Answer: 4.5*10^6

Explanation : According to Beer lambert law A = a() * b * c, where A is the measured absorbance, a() is a wavelength-dependent absorptivity coefficient, b is the path length, and c is the analyte concentration.

Therefore, absorbance is directly proportional to cell concentration.
